WebThe BreastScreen NSW program is free for women over 40 years of age with women 50 to 74 years of age particularly encouraged to attend and a doctor's referral is not required. Women with unusual breast changes such as lump, pain, nipple discharge should contact their general practitioner before making an appointment at BreastScreen NSW.
